answersLogoWhite

0

When a software developer or developers are tasked with creating something they need to roughly calculate the different aspects of that job. These estimates give the business an idea of how much the project will cost. Among the estimations they need to work out are how long it will take to complete the project, how many people will be needed, how much and what kind of hard/software will be needed.

User Avatar

Wiki User

10y ago

What else can I help you with?

Related Questions

Why cost estimation is the most challenging tasks in project management?

I wouldn't consider it the most challenging, but it is challenging. The problem is that there are lots of unknowns when it comes to costs for a project, especially a software project, where changes are always there. The Project Manager has the tough job to balance between the cost estimation and keep the project in check of its budget. There are lots of cost estimating techniques out there.


What do you mean by decomposition techniques in software engineering?

Software project estimation is a form of problem solving, and in most cases, the problem to be solved (i.e. developing a cost and effort estimate for a softwa project) is too,complex to be considered in one piece. For this reason, we decompose the problem, recharacterizing it as a set of smaller(and hopefully,more manageable)problems. The decomposition approach was discussed from two different points of view: 1). decomposition of the problem and 2).decompostion of the process. Estimation uses one or both forms of partitioning.But before an estimate can be made, the project planner must understand the scope of the software to be built and generate an estimation of its"size".


Who wrote the book Software Estimation?

Released in 2006, the book Software Estimation; Demystifying the Black Art (Best Practices (Microsoft)) was written by Steve McConnell. Steve McConnell is a CEO, and Chief software engineer at Construx Software.


Why cost estimation is important for project management?

Cost estimation is important because each project has the risk of added costs that weren't consider up front throwing the project into a state where you may not have the budget required to continue working on the project. The cost estimation should include the initial assessment plus % available for added costs.


What is the software engineering problem?

Lines of code and function points were described as measures from which productivity metrics can be computed. LOC and FP data are used in two ways during software project estimation: (1) as an estimation variable to "size" each element of the software and (2) as baseline metrics collected from past projects and used in conjunction with estimation variables to develop cost and effort projections.


What is COCOMO model?

COnstructive COst MOdel (COCOMO) is an algorithmic Software Cost Estimation Model developed by Barry Boehm. The model uses a basic regression formula, with parameters that are derived from historical project data and current project characteristics.


Where can project costing software be found?

Project costing software can be found at the UNIT4 Business Software website. This software is a valuable tool in determining the initial cost of a project.


Explain the impact of Requirements Engineering on the success of a software project?

Requirements Engineering plays a crucial role in the success of a software project. It helps ensure that the project meets the needs and expectations of the stakeholders. By properly gathering, analyzing, and documenting requirements, it helps in identifying the scope, functionality, and constraints of the software. This leads to better planning, estimation, and resource allocation, reducing the chances of project failure or delays. It also helps in managing risks, improving communication among team members, and enhancing customer satisfaction.


What is software project?

In general terms, software which is using by Project Managers is called as Project manager Software. There are many types of useful software available for project managers according to their industry and work systems. Software like JIRA, HADOOP etc are also using by Project Managers.


What type of software is Microsoft project?

It is applications software used for project management.


What is project manager software?

In general terms, software which is using by Project Managers is called as Project manager Software. There are many types of useful software available for project managers according to their industry and work systems. Software like JIRA, HADOOP etc are also using by Project Managers.


Why do you need a good WBS to use project management software?

As part of managing the project, there are many processes that are directly based on the WBS as part of the Scope Baseline. They are: 1. Cost Estimation 2. Quality Planning 3. Risk Identification 4. Procurement Planning 5. Defining Activities for Project Schedule 6. Budget Determination So, without a good WBS, the chances of your projects success are very low and you cannot use the project management software effectively